It's intended to build > >> + a topological view of the CoreSight components based on a DT > >> + specification and configure the right serie of components when a > >> + trace source gets enabled. > > > > Why does this need to be duplicated by each architecture wanting to make > > use of coresight capabilities defined under drivers/coresight? Can't we > > instead have this menuconfig and associated suboptions defined by a core > > Kconfig file, then have HAVE_ARCH_CORESIGHT_TRACE or something which can > > be selected by architectures wanting to make use of the framework? > > > > Will > > "arch/arm/Kconfig.debug" and "arch/arm64/Kconfig.debug" already have a > fair amount of duplication so I wasn't sure if this is the approach > you guys wanted to take. I agree that a common core Kconfig file > would make much more sense and I see a couple of ways to do this: > > 1) lib/Kconfig.debug being sourced by both arm/Kconfig.debug and > arm64/Kconfig.debug. We can add a lib/Kconfig.coresight or > lib/Kconfig.arm and source them the same way. > > 2) Adding coresight entries to the Kconfig.debug made sense a while > back. Maybe it is time to move them to drivers/coresight/Kconfig... > That way it would be easily accessible by both arm and arm64.
Since the C files and Makefile are in drivers/coresight/, it makes sense to add a drivers/coresight/Kconfig that could be sourced from arch/arm*/Kconfig (we do this with PCI for example).
